Samsung Fire surges past OK Financial Group for third straight win

Samsung Fire, last place in professional volleyball last season, has turned things around. They swept OK Financial Group to extend their winning streak to three games.

Samsung Fire swept OK Financial Group 3-0 (25-23, 25-21, 25-19) in three sets in a home match of the Dodram 2023-2024 V-League Men’s Division at Chungmu Gymnasium in Daejeon on Sunday. The three-game winning streak improved Samsung Fire’s record to 3-1 (8 points), dropping OK Financial Group (5-2, 2-1) to second place.

The first set was won by foreign player Yosvani Hernandez, who exploded for 13 points. They closed out the set with a late attack at 24-23. In the second set, OK Financial Group’s reception was greatly shaken as Samsung Fire’s Korean counterparts joined the fray. After taking the second set 25-21, Samsung Fire closed out the match in the third set.

Yosubani scored a game-high 27 points, while Kim Jung-ho added 15 points and Park Sung-jin finished with nine points.

In the women’s match at Gwangju Pepper Stadium, traveling team GS Caltex battled Pepper Savings Bank to a full set before coming from behind to win 3-2 (21-25 23-25 25-20 25-19 15-12). GS Caltex, which won its opening three matches in a row, accumulated eight points to remain in third place.

GS Caltex foreign players Giselle Silva scored 40 points and Kang So-hwi scored 25 points.
